将maven项目导入Eclipse的最佳实践

时间:2013-07-19 17:35:41

标签: eclipse maven

对所有这些都很陌生,所以想做这个场景的最佳实践:

我从GitHub签出一个有POM文件的项目,所以它是一个maven项目。 现在我想在Eclipse中编写代码。 好的,我首先运行像

这样的东西
mvn clean package 
mvn eclipse:eclipse

然后从Eclipse我说File-> Import-> Maven项目?

或者我在Eclipse中打开一个项目并在eclipse中使用Maven2Eclipse项目来构建它?

2 个答案:

答案 0 :(得分:4)

您不需要两个maven命令。

如果你有正确的插件,你可以只做File-> Import-> Maven project->'选择项目'

M2Eclipse将识别它并进行所需的所有更改。

答案 1 :(得分:2)

一种方法是在eclipse中使用EGit插件。在Git Repositories视图中克隆repo,然后在那里有一个“import maven project”选项。这样,该项目被eclipse认可为git repo和maven项目。

mvn eclipse:eclipse会为你生成一个eclipse .project,所以是的,你可以简单地将它作为maven项目导入。即使你没有把它作为maven项目打开,m2e插件也会“转换它”。

无论哪种方式,你都会使用m2e来构建。